HR 14657 · 94th Congress · Armed Forces and National Security

A bill to amend section 619 of title 38, United States Code, in order to authorize the Administrator to expand the current program providing therapeutic and rehabilitation activities for certain veterans.

Introduced 1976-07-01· Sponsored by Rep. Thone, Charles [R-NE-1]· House

Latest: Referred to House Committee on Veterans' Affairs.(1976-07-01)

Plain Language Summary

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Authorizes the Administrator of Veterans' Affairs, in providing therapeutic and rehabilitation activities, to provide for the participation of patients and members in Veterans' Administration health facilities in the assemblage of poppies or other similar projects carried out at such facilities, which are sponsored by a national veterans service organization or its auxiliary. Directs that patients and members be compensated by the sponsoring organization for their participation in such programs.…
